Subject: Handover — profile store sharding

Hi Dareth,

Passing the pager with the Wrenfold profile-store resharding at step 3 of 5. Shards 0–11 are migrated and dual-writing; 12–23 still read from the legacy cluster. The cutover script is idempotent, so rerunning after a failure is safe. Watch the replication-lag dashboard — anything over 90s means pause the migration. Runbook is linked from the shard tracker. If the lag alarms fire and the runbook doesn't help, contact the data platform lead.

alerts address for bafog-tawep: ulavan_sorwyn_fraax@kelviworks.local

## Step 3 — Wayfarer Audio Guide: tile migration

Move the audio tile manifests from the old bucket to the regional store before enabling the new player build. Run the sync script once per gallery, then verify checksums. Visitors on cached builds fall back automatically, so no downtime window is needed. The migration job reads its settings from the block below.

service settings:
ulaael:
  log_level: warn
  metrics_host: metrics.ulaael.tolvaqsys.internal
  pin: 7801
  pool_size: 16

## Releases

Snapshot tests for Glimmerpane UI components run on every release branch via the Fennwick runner. Any pixel diff above 0.1% blocks the tag. Reviewers should confirm the baseline hashes match the audit manifest before approval. Release artifacts are signed prior to upload, using the key that follows.

signing key of fajop-tahop = bky9_qdL6xeDv7

### FAQ: Why did Vellum template renders slow down after the cache change?

The Vellum renderer now checks a signed cache manifest before reusing compiled templates, which adds latency on cold starts but prevents stale partials. If the manifest verifier locks itself after repeated mismatches, renders fall back to uncached mode. To re-arm the verifier, enter the recovery passphrase below.

strongbox words: wenix-ulador